Pengenalan NetBeans

NetBeans NetBeans IDE (Integrated Development Environment) adalah sebuah lingkungan pengembangan terintegrasi yang tersedia untuk Windows, Mac, Linux, dan Solaris. Proyek NetBeans terdiri dari open-source IDE dan platform aplikasi, yang memungkinkan pengembang untuk secara cepat membuat web, enterprise, desktop, dan aplikasi mobile menggunakan platform Java, serta JavaFX, PHP, JavaScript dan Ajax, Ruby dan Ruby on Rails, Groovy dan Grails, dan C/C++.

Proyek NetBeans didukung oleh komunitas pengembang yang ekstensif dan menawarkan dokumentasi dan sumberdaya pelatihan serta beragam pilihan plugin pihak ketiga.
Pada pembahasan ini digunakan NetBeans versi 7.1. IDE NetBeans 7.1 memperkenalkan dukungan untuk JavaFX 2.0 dengan mengaktifkan siklus kompilasi/debug/profil pengembangan secara penuh untuk aplikasi jafaFX 2.0. Rilis ini juga menyediakan perangkat tambahan Swing GUI Builder secara signifikan, dukungan CSS3, dan perangkat untuk visual debugging untuk Swing dan antarmuka pengguna untuk JavaFX. Tambahan termasuk dukungan Git yang terintegrasi ke dalam IDE, fitur baru PHP debugging, beberapa perbaikan pada JavaEE dan Maven, dan banyak lainnya.NetBeans 7.1 tersedia dalam bahasa Inggris, Brasil, Portugis, Jepang, Rusia dan Cina.
Instalasi NetBeansUntuk dapat menggunakan NetBeans, kita harus menginstalasi NetBeans dan JDK. Keduanya dapat di download secara gratis di http://www.netbeans.com/ dan http://www.oracle.com/. Supaya lebih mudah dalam menginstall, install JDK terlebih dulu baru kemudian install NetBeans.Memulai NetbeansJalankan Netbeans Star Menu atau Shorcut.
Gambar Proses Pengaktifan Netbeans

Tampilan Netbeans Aktif
1.      Membuat Proyek BaruBerikut adalah Langkah-langkah Pembuatan Project baru dengan editor netbeans:

v   File (pada toolbar) Ã New Project, sehingga muncul jendela New project
v   Pada jendela New project, terdapat dua langkah atau step, yaitu Choose Project (pemilihan jenis proyek) dan Name and Location (penentuan nama dan lokasi file program).
v   Pada langkah Choose project, pilih java pada Kotak pilihan Categories, kemudian pilihJava Application pada kotak pilihan Projects.
Gambar  Pertama pada Project Baru



v   Klik Next, untuk melanjutkan proses kelangkah Name And Location (pemberian nama dan lokasi file).
v   Pada isian Project Name ketik Latihan (Sebagai nama Proyek).


Gambar Langkah kedua untuk Project Baruv   Pada isian Project Location terisi secara default direktori kerja sekarang, saudara bisa menggantinya dengan cara menekan tombol Browse…di sebelah kanan.
v   Pilihan Create Main Class adalah opsi untuk membuat kelas main atau tidak. Kelas main diperlukan untuk dijadikan sebagai program utama yang pertama kali akan dijalankan oleh mesin Java. Tanpa Kelas main, sebuah kelas tidak akan bisa dijalankan.
v   Pilihan Set as Main Project hanyalah opsi untuk menentukan proyek ini sebagai proyek aktif (yang dijalankan ketika saudara melakun kompilasi). Hal ini terjadi ketika saudara dalam jendela Netbeans membuka beberapa project, sehingga untuk menentukan yang aktif atau yang dijalankan, adalah melalui pemilihan project sebagaiMain Project (proyek utama).
v   Klik Finish untuk mengakhiri.



Gambar Form yang Terbentuk
2.      Menambah Form Dalam Proyek
Secara default (pertama kali dibuat), proyek terdiri atas kelas utama saja, belum memiliki form/jendela GUI. Untuk bisa menampilkan form, perlu dilakukan langkah-langkah sebgai berikut:
v  Masih dari Latihan 2 sebelumnya, dari jendela Project pilih package Latihan, klik kanan dan pilih New Ã  JFrame Form

Gambar Membuat Form Baru
v  Pada jendela New JFrame Form, masukan nama form yang akan menjadi nama kelasnya (pada kotak Class Name), selanjutnya klik tombol Finish

Gambar untuk Form Baru
Isian location adalah penentuan letak paket, sedangkan isian Package menentukan nama paket yang akan ditempati oleh file dari form baru tersebut, dan isian created file sudah terisi secara otomatis dari konfigurasi atau isian sebelumnya (dari Class Name sampai Package).

Gambar Form yang terbentuk
Panel-panel pada Netbeans:
Ø  Panel project
Panel Project menampilkan Proyek yang telah dirancang.

Gambar Panel project
Ø  Panel Files
Panel Files menampilkan file-file dalam sebuah proyek yang dirancang, baik file java(*.java) atau file bytcode(*.class). melalui panel Projects dan Files, dapat membuka file-fileyang telah dibuat pada area kerja.

Gambar Panel Files
Ø  Panel Pallete
Panel Pallete merupakan panel yang menydiakan tool-tool untuk mendesign form berbasis grafis (GUI). Tool ini dibagi menjadi beberapa kategori, dimana setiap kategori menyediakan tool-tool GUI Builder sesuai dengan kategorinya. Untuk menggunakannya, saudara tinggal menyeret tool-tool kedalam ara desain.

Gambar Panel Pallete
Ø  Panel Propertis
Panel properties berfungsi untuk menampilkan property komponen yang aktif ntuk mengatur property yang dimiliki oleh suatu komponen.

Gambar Panel Properties
Ø  Panel Inspector
Panel inspector akan tampil apabila mengaktifkan dokumen yang mengandung container atau pemrograman grafis (GUI). Pada panel inspector inimenampilkan komponen yang digunakan oleh file yang bersangkutan, seperti container, komponen control, komponen menu, komponen border dan lainnya.

Gambar Panel Inspector
x




Comments